Job DescriptionThe Client Design Authority undertakes a vital role in ensuring that key defence infrastructure that interfaces is safe and fit for purpose.
ResponsibilitiesThe Technical Author will support the technical capability of the Design Authority (DA). This role is suited to Technical Authors with experience in an Engineering Discipline and will involve:
- Authoring and reviewing technical documents, drawings, schematics, and design documentation.
- Interpreting engineering technical data and ensuring consistency across documentation.
- Managing version control and configuration management processes.
- Applying technical documentation standards and structured authoring principles.
- Experience in technical authoring within an engineering, defence or industrial environment.
- Experience working within the nuclear industry or another high-hazard industry is advantageous.
- Ability to interpret engineering technical data, drawings, schematics, and design documentation.
- Excellent written communication skills with exceptional attention to detail and accuracy.
- Experience with document management systems, version control and configuration management processes.
- Knowledge of technical documentation standards and structured authoring principles.
- HNC (or equivalent qualification/experience) in a relevant engineering discipline.
- Degree (or equivalent qualification/experience) in a relevant engineering discipline.
- Professional status such as Incorporated Engineer (IEng) or equivalent industry standing.
Requires sole UK national with SC clearance.
Mainly remote working with 1–2 days per month on site at Faslane.
